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$103.64 | 8.464% | $112.4121 | $112.41 | $112.40 | $112.40 |
Purchase #2 | $77.79 | 10.845% | $86.2263 | $86.23 | $86.25 | $86.20 |
Purchase #3 | $196.83 | 6.392% | $209.4114 | $209.41 | $209.40 | $209.40 |
Purchase #4 | $86.58 | 10.253% | $95.457 | $95.46 | $95.45 | $95.50 |
Purchase #5 | $149.57 | 8.712% | $162.6005 | $162.60 | $162.60 | $162.60 |
Purchase #6 | $34.87 | 10.295% | $38.4599 | $38.46 | $38.45 | $38.50 |
Purchase #7 | $238.64 | 7.493% | $256.5213 | $256.52 | $256.50 | $256.50 |
7 purchase totals = | $887.92 | $961.0885 | $961.09 | $961.05 | $961.10 |
